Industrial Big Power 65cm 26 Inch Misting Fan with 29L Water Tank
China Industrial Big Power 65cm 26 Inch Misting Fan with 29L Water Tank, Find details and Price about China Ventilation, Floor from Industrial Big Power 65cm 26 Inch Misting Fan with 29L Water Tank